Periodic table
The periodic table is central to GCSE Chemistry. Learners use it to identify elements, atomic numbers, mass numbers, groups, periods, patterns in reactivity, and links between electron structure and chemical behaviour.
It supports work on atomic structure, bonding, Group 1, Group 7, Group 0, transition metals, formulae, equations, and quantitative chemistry.

Learners should use it to
- find atomic numbers and relative atomic masses
- identify metals, non-metals, groups, and periods
- predict electron arrangements for atoms and ions
- explain trends in Group 1, Group 7, and Group 0
- support calculations involving formulae and equations
